David Brunt Life story
Sir David Brunt, KBE, FRS was a Welsh meteorologist. He was Professor of Meteorology at Imperial College, London from 1934 to 1952. He was vice-president of the Royal Society from 1949 to 1957. The Brunt Ice Shelf in Antarctica is named after him.
